Nowadays,moviegoers are no longer satisfied with merely watching the show
on screen,and eager to step into the scenes and experience the daily lives of
characters.A popular movie or TV drama has the power to make a city famous and
generate a tourism boom.
Qingdao in Shandong
A famous film during last year's Spring Festival was The Wandering Earth II.
Interestingly,90 percent of the film was actually shot in Qingdao.For sci-fi fans or
film enthusiasts,visiting Qingdao to explore the movie's filming locations has
become a popular trend.During the Spring Festival the city recorded more than 3.75
million trips.
Dali in Yunnan
,2
With the premiere (of the TV drama Meet Yourself earlier last year,the
Dali Bai Autonomous prefecture emerged as a highly sought-after tourism
destination.The scenery and relaxing pace of life described in the drama lead to a
tourism boom in Dali.During the Spring Festival,Yunnan province received the
second most tourists in the nation with tourism revenue (of 38.4 billion yuan,
ranking top.

Thirty-nine-year-old Liang Jiangbo,who became the first blind person to eam a
postgraduate degree from Tsinghua University last month,said he planned to devote
himself to helping more disabled people better integrate into socety
Born in Bengbu,Anhui province,Liang said his disability made his educational
journey tough and uneven.His parents spared no effort to give him the chance to
attend a regular school at ten,where his peers treated him as a normal student.Later,
he went to a special school and his classmates tried to dissuade him from trying to
get into a regular university and instead encouraged him to learn massage()and
think about running a shop to make a living.He was admitted to Beijing Union
University in 2006,where he majored in acupuncture and massage therapy.There he
also made sure to take part in social activities to build better connections.He said
that applying for a place in the social work master's program at Tsinghua was not a
sudden act.It was his dream school when he was a child.

Last week,Amazon CEO Andy Jassy sent an email to his employees warning
that artificial intelligence could displace them."We will need fewer people doing
some of the current jobs,but more people doing other types of jobs,"he wrote.
Nothing in his email was shocking.Technological advances as far back as the
printing machine have got rid of some jobs while creating many others.The real
danger is that too much reliance on AI could lead to a generation of young people
unequipped for the jobs of the future because they have never learned to think
creatively or critically.
The brain continues to develop and mature into one's mid-20s,but like a muscle,
it needs to be exercised and challenged to grow stronger.Technology,especially AI,
can block this development by doing the work that the brain is expected to do.
A study last year analyzed brain electrical activity of university students during
the activities of handwriting and typing.Those who were handwriting showed
higher levels of neural()activation across more brain regions."Whenever
handwriting movements are included as a learning strategy,more of the brain gets
stimulated,resulting in the formation of more complex neural network connectivity,"
the researchers noted."However,most students in colleges and many in high schools
use AI tools to take notes and summarize lectures."
Why commit information to memory when AI tools can provide answers at our
fingertips?For one thing,the brain can't draw connections between ideas that aren't
there.Nothing comes from nothing.Creativity doesn't happen unless the brain is
engaged.
College and high-school students also increasingly use AI tools to write papers,
perform mathematical proofs,and create computer code.That means they don't
learn how to think through,express or defend ideas.
"Why hire a brainless bachelor's degree holder for a job that an AI tool can do
at lower costs and with no complaint?"Andy Jassy asked by the end of the letter.

Butter made from air instead of cows?A California-based startup claims to
have worked out a complex process that eliminates the need for the animals while
making its dairy-free alternative taste just as good.
Savor,backed by the Microsoft billionaire Bill Gates,has been experimenting
with creating dairy-free alternatives to ice-cream,cheese,and milk by utilizing(
)a thermo chemical process that allows it to build fat molecules,creating chains
of carbon dioxide,hydrogen and oxygen.The company has now announced a new
animal-free butter alternative.
Reducing meat and dairy consumption is one of the key ways that humanity
can reduce its environmental impact,as livestock production is a significant source
of greenhouse gases,and Savor says its products will have a significantly lower
carbon footprint than animal-based ones,The"butter"could potentially come in at
less than 0.8g CO2 equivalent per calorie.The standard climate footprint of real
unsalted butter with 80%fat is approximately 2.4g CO2 equivalent per calorie.
Kathleen Alexander,Savor's chief executive,said:"We are currently
pre-commercial and working through regulatory approval to be able to sell our butter.
We are not expecting to be able to move forward with any kind of sales until at least
2025”

Meat and dairy alternatives have become more and more popular in recent
years,but some fall short in terms of flavour.Savor says the flavour of its butter is
more exact.The question now is whether buyers will take to such synthetic fats.
Getting people to give up their favourite dairy and meat items for more
experimental"foods may pose a challenge.
Advocating for the initiative in an online blog post,Gates wrote:"The idea of
switching to lab-made fats and oils may seem strange at first.But their potential to
significantly reduce our carbon footprint is huge.By making use of proven
technologies and processes,we get one step closer to achieving our climate goals.
The process doesn't release any greenhouse gases,and it uses no farmland and less
than a thousandth of the water that traditional agriculture does.And most
importantly,it tastes really good-like the real thing,because chemically it is."
